The Theatre Portal
Theatre is that branch of the performing arts concerned with the creation of stories or narratives for (or with) an audience using combinations of acting, speech, gesture, music, dance, object manipulation, sound and spectacle — indeed, any one or more elements of the other performing arts. In addition to standard narrative dialogue style, theatre takes such forms as opera, musicals, ballet, mime, kabuki, classical Indian dance, Chinese opera, mummers' plays, improvisation, story theater and pantomime.

In this month
- October 1971 – Michael Billington, Britain's longest-serving theatre critic, joined The Guardian
- 1 October 1684 – Death of Pierre Corneille, often called the "founder of French tragedy"
- 6 October 1952 – Premier of Agatha Christie's The Mousetrap, the longest running show in London's West End
- 10 October 1881 – Opening of the Savoy Theatre in London, built by impresario Richard D'Oyly Carte
- 16 October 1854 – Birth of Oscar Wilde, whose plays include Salome and The Importance of Being Earnest
- 17 October 1896 – First performance of Anton Chekhov's (pictured) The Seagull was booed by the audience and Chekhov decided that he was finished writing plays
- 23 October 1969 – Announcement that Samuel Beckett won the Nobel Prize in Literature
- 28 October 1994 – Premier of 'Art', an award-winning play by French playwright Yasmina Reza

Did you know...
- ...that according to the Marlovian theory of Shakespeare authorship, works attributed to William Shakespeare were actually written by playwright Christopher Marlowe (pictured), who faked his own death in 1593 to continue writing under a Shakespeare pseudonym?
- ..that Heroes actor David Anders was recognized with a Back Stage West Garland Award along with the ensemble cast of The Diary of Anne Frank, for their 2001 production?
- ...that A Very Merry Unauthorized Children's Scientology Pageant had its name changed due to threats of litigation from the Church of Scientology?
